IN THE H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T MADRAS DATED: 28.02.2017 C O R A M THE HONOURABLE Mrs.JUSTICE PUSHPA SATHYANARAYANA Tr.C.M.P.No.704 of 2014 and M.P.No.1 of 2014 A.Sumathi .. Petitioner -Vs-
S.Arulselvan .. Respondent Transfer Civil Miscellaneous Petition filed under Section 24 of C.P.C praying to withdraw and transfer the case in H.M.O.P.No.159/2012 pending on the file of Sub-Court, Tambaram and to the file of I Additional Family Court, Chennai.
For petitioner .. No Appearance O R D E R When the matter was taken up for hearing on 22.02.2017, there was no representation for the petitioner. Hence, the matter was directed to be posted on 24.02.2017. Even when the matter was listed on 28.02.2017, there was no representation for the PUSHPA SATHYANARAYANA.J srn petitioner. Hence, the Registry was directed to list the matter on 28.02.2017 under the caption 'for dismissal'.
2. Even today (28.02.2017), when the matter is called, there is no representation for the petitioner either in person or through counsel. Hence, the Transfer Civil Miscellaneous Petition is dismissed for non prosecution. No costs.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petition is closed.
